Reliability is #1 reason for Hirebotics
Most companies that use robots to manufacture parts only make money when their robot is running. However, for Hirebotics this is especially true; their robot-workers are hired out to other companies and they literally do not get paid if their robot doesn’t work!
Hirebotics is the first Robots-as-a-Service (RaaS) provider offering full, turnkey integration of collaborative robots for hire. The majority of companies that use hired robot workers are looking to fill labor shortages. The Hirebotics model is designed to be just like hiring a person, but instead the customer gets a robot worker.
Matt Bush, COO and Co-Founder of Hirebotics, knows that partnering with SCHUNK and using PGN+ grippers on their robot workers is the best choice for reliability and speed: “In the past, we used grippers that were not able to handle the requirements that we have for speed and reliability. Since changing to SCHUNK grippers we no longer have to think about the reliability of the gripper, it just works.”
A wide range of standardized products, as well as customization ability, drives HandlingTech’s supplier decision
German company HandlingTech Automation-Systems has been providing customers all over the world with innovative and primarily robotized automation solutions since 1994. Their portfolio ranges from standard systems to highly complex special machines.
The assembly hall at HandlingTech is bursting at the seams at present, with every square foot being used to push forward with customer projects. Thomas Imme, Project Manager for Mechanical Production at HandlingTech, draws on SCHUNK'S extensive gripper portfolio for his automation projects without exception. He says: "No matter what robotized automation solution we are planning and implementing for our customers, I always find what I need in SCHUNK's PGN-plus-P portfolio when looking for a suitable gripper – and if ever something isn't standard, they will help me devise a customized solution."
Despite widespread standardization, HandlingTech highlighted an issue that is often seen in the industry - the individual requirements of customers can pose a challenge for engineers at successful companies time and time again. Having a product with a full range offered as standard, as well as the ability to customize for very specific applications, helps to reduce this complexity significantly.
Imme values individual, highly reliable support from his suppliers when choosing the correct gripping systems, and relies on the highly practical support during commissioning. "The geometries of the grippers are already stored in the CAD tools and selection of these is made simple and is incorporated into the planning and also tested on the computer right away using a simulation."
Precision and premium quality: The difference is in the details
Bystronic, a Swiss company, provides automated solutions for bending sheet metal. Outstanding precision and repeat accuracy are paramount in the process used to bend sheet metal, often with complex geometries.
Bystronic Application Engineer, Jochen Schreiber, is responsible for selecting the appropriate gripper technologies. He says: "For the mobile equipping automation function of the compact bending press, I chose a SCHUNK benchmark parallel gripper PGN-plus-P because its patented multi-tooth guidance allows workpieces to be gripped and fed to the press with high precision and high repeat accuracy. In this case, the quality of the end product depends entirely on the precision of the feed."
As a company, Bystronic rates precision and premium quality above all else without compromise. Companies that place this level of emphasis on quality not only expect this from the overall solution, but also from every individual component that is implemented in that solution.
